P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To make one recording bit size smaller by irradiating a recording medium having at least one or more kinds of phosphors with proximity field light to annihilate the fluorescent characteristic of the prescribed phosphor in a microregion. SOLUTION: The distance between a microopening 50 and a high-polymer recording thin film 1 of an optical probe 5 is controlled to be constant at a wavelength or below and consequently, a proximity field light 51 is emitted from the microopening 50 and is irradiated to the recording thin film 1. The spot size, at which the recording thin film 1 is irradiated with the proximity field light 51, is nearly equal to the size of the microopening 50. Namely, only the microregion of the recording thin film 1 is irradiated by using the proximity field light 51. The recording thin film is irradiated with the light having the wavelength corresponding to the prescribed phosphor, by which the phosphor is photooxidized and the fluorescent characteristic thereof is annihilated. When the recording film 1 is irradiated with the proximity field light 51 emitted from the microopening 50 in this manner, the fluorescent characteristic of a phosphor B of the region I:10 is annihilated by the selected extinction light 9. |
